Bengaluru: ‘JDS will go extinct in next Assembly election’

Bengaluru: Bharatiya Janata Yuva Morcha (BJYM) National President and Bengaluru South MP Tejasvi Surya slammed Janata Dal (Secular) leader H. D. Kumaraswamy on Monday January 2 for comparing Union Home Minister Amit Shah to chief Nazi propagandist Joseph Goebbels.

Speaking to mediapersons in Ahmedabad on Monday, he said, Kumaraswamy’s remarks revealed his “political frustration” over the fact that his “endangered” party will “go extinct” in the upcoming Karnataka Assembly elections.

Kumaraswamy has recently attacked Shah, referring to him as a “political chameleon” and the “reincarnation of Goebbels.”

Surya was in Ahmedabad for the BJYM’s Sushasan Yatra, during which young BJP leaders from other states will visit Gujarat to learn about the development model that the State had established under the leadership of Prime Minister Narendra Modi.
